aether::mpl::gather_required< std::tuple< T, Ts... > > Struct Template Reference

#include <mpl.hh>

Public Types

using type = typename cons< T, typename gather_required< std::tuple< Ts... >>::type >::type
 

Member Typedef Documentation

template<typename T , typename... Ts>
using aether::mpl::gather_required< std::tuple< T, Ts... > >::type = typename cons<T, typename gather_required<std::tuple<Ts...>>::type>::type